This pic is of my current stats from my website about watching TV online.

I bless God for changing my whole philosophy on that one, including these tips that helped get the number of visitors up:

 

  1. I turned off the Feedburner email subscriber function because my email list had grown to over 6,000 people that I didn’t want to spam with posts. That was holding me back from posting.

  2. That also freed me up to look at it more as a video indexing site where I could post aplenty about anything I found interesting, and leave it to the visitors from Google mostly to find what they wanted.

  3. I finally got into a formula of putting Header 1, Header 2 and Header 3 tags into the posts - just Google it to find out what I mean about header tags, if you’re interested in gaining web traffic.

  4. And while you’re at it and if you’re using Wordpress to run your site (not the free Wordpress.com, but the Wordpress.org chumpie), Google the All-in-One-SEO plugin and download it. It’s cool and it helped my traffic.

  5. FYI - People love watching stuff online. Check Google Hot Trends for the latest YouTube thing people are wanting, and if it’s not porn — write about it. If you blog it right, they will come…

  6. Those cute little doohickeys I put in my post titles on WatchFreeEpisodes.com (got that idea from Blue Hat SEO) — those help you stand out in Google’s search engine results pages.
